MillerKnoll is seeking a Sales Enablement Strategist to enhance the effectiveness of their sales teams and dealer partners through tailored enablement initiatives. The role requires strong relationship-building skills, project management abilities, and a focus on measurable outcomes
Job Summary
The role involves owning the design, execution, and measurement of enablement initiatives for assigned sales segments.
Candidates must translate complex market and product information into practical assets tailored to how sellers actually work.
Success is measured by field performance, ensuring sellers are better equipped, more confident, and effective in their markets.
